# Functions needed for training models
from __future__ import unicode_literals, print_function, division
from io import open
import unicodedata
import string
import re
import random
from random import shuffle
import torch
import torch.nn as nn
from torch.autograd import Variable
from torch import optim
import torch.nn.functional as F
import numpy as np
import sys
import os
import time
import math
import pickle
from role_assignment_functions import *
from evaluation import *
from rolelearner.role_learning_tensor_product_encoder import RoleLearningTensorProductEncoder
use_cuda = torch.cuda.is_available()
# Train for a single batch
# Inputs:
# training_set: the batch
# encoder: the encoder
# decoder: the decoder
# encoder_optimizer: optimizer for the encoder
# decoder_optimizer: optimizer for the decoder
# criterion: the loss function
# input_to_output: function that maps input sequences to correct outputs
def train(training_set, encoder, decoder, encoder_optimizer, decoder_optimizer, criterion, input_to_output):
loss = 0
# Get the decoder's outputs outputs for these inputs
logits = decoder(encoder(training_set),
len(training_set[0]),
[parse_digits(elt) for elt in training_set])
encoder_optimizer.zero_grad()
decoder_optimizer.zero_grad()
# Compute the loss over each index in the output
for index, logit in enumerate(logits):
if use_cuda:
loss += criterion(logit, Variable(torch.LongTensor([[input_to_output(x) for x in training_set]])).cuda().transpose(0,2)[index].view(-1))
else:
loss += criterion(logit, Variable(torch.LongTensor([[input_to_output(x) for x in training_set]])).transpose(0,2)[index].view(-1))
# Backpropagate the loss
loss.backward()
encoder_optimizer.step()
decoder_optimizer.step()
return loss / len(training_set)

# Generate batches from a data set
def batchify(data, batch_size):
length_sorted_dict = {}
max_length = 0
for item in data:
if len(item) not in length_sorted_dict:
length_sorted_dict[len(item)] = []
length_sorted_dict[len(item)].append(item)
if len(item) > max_length:
max_length = len(item)
batches = []
for seq_len in range(max_length + 1):
if seq_len in length_sorted_dict:
for batch_num in range(len(length_sorted_dict[seq_len])//batch_size):
this_batch = length_sorted_dict[seq_len][batch_num*batch_size:(batch_num+1)*batch_size]
batches.append(this_batch)
shuffle(batches)
return batches

# Perform a full training run for a digit
# sequence task. Inputs:
# encoder: the encoder
# decoder: the decoder
# train_data: the training set
# dev_data: the development set
# file_prefix: file identifier to use when saving the weights
# input_to_output: function for mapping input sequences to the correct outputs
# max_epochs: maximum number of epochs to train for before halting
# patience: maximum number of epochs to train without dev set improvement before halting
# print_every: number of batches to go through before printing the current status
# learning_rate: learning rate
# batch_size: batch_size
def train_iters(encoder, decoder, train_data, dev_data, file_prefix, input_to_output, max_epochs=100, patience=1, print_every=1000, learning_rate=0.001, batch_size=32):
print_loss_total = 0
# Train using Adam
encoder_optimizer = optim.Adam(encoder.parameters(), lr=learning_rate)
decoder_optimizer = optim.Adam(decoder.parameters(), lr=learning_rate)
# Negative log likelihood loss
criterion = nn.NLLLoss()
best_loss = 1000000
epochs_since_improved = 0
# Group the data into batches
training_sets = batchify(train_data, batch_size)
dev_data = batchify(dev_data, batch_size)
loss_total = 0
# File for printing updates
progress_file = open("models/progress_" + file_prefix, "w")
# Iterate over epocjs
for epoch in range(max_epochs):
improved_this_epoch = 0
shuffle(training_sets)
# Iterate over batches
for batch, training_set in enumerate(training_sets):
# Train for this batch
loss = train(training_set, encoder, decoder, encoder_optimizer, decoder_optimizer, criterion, input_to_output)
# Print an update and save the weights every print_every iterations
if batch % print_every == 0:
this_loss = dev_loss(encoder, decoder, criterion, dev_data, input_to_output)
progress_file.write(str(epoch) + "\t" + str(batch) + "\t" + str(this_loss.item()) + "\n")
if this_loss.data[0] < best_loss:
improved_this_epoch = 1
best_loss = this_loss
torch.save(encoder.state_dict(), "models/encoder_" + file_prefix + ".weights")
torch.save(decoder.state_dict(), "models/decoder_" + file_prefix + ".weights")
# Early stopping
if not improved_this_epoch:
epochs_since_improved += 1
if epochs_since_improved == patience:
print("Patience exceeded, finish training early")
break
else:
epochs_since_improved = 0
